Double perovskites, which can host two different transition metal cations at the B-sites of its perovskite derived structure, provide the possibility to explore the interplay of localized 3d transition metals and the relatively delocalized 4d or 5d transition metals within the same structure. This interplay gives rise to extraordinary magnetic properties. In this overview article, we summarize our recent computational efforts in understanding the curious properties of magnetic double perovskites with 3d and 4d/5d transition metal ions, make predictions on new functionalities in known compounds of this family, engineering functionalities via chemical modifications/doping and prediction on a new set of magnetic 3d-4d/5d double perovkite compounds, which may be synthesized to explore and expand further this interesting family.
